## Deploying the Gatewick Proctor Queue

Deploys are pretty painless: push to main, wait for the pipeline, then watch the queue drain dashboard for five minutes. If candidates pile up mid-exam, roll back first and ask questions later — the queue replays safely. Everything the workers care about lives in one config block, shown here for reference.

settings of bafof-yagef:
JOROX_PIN=8740
JOROX_TENANT=pelox
JOROX_METRICS_HOST=metrics.jorox.qorvelworks.internal
JOROX_SEAL=seal_c78f63c1
JOROX_STANDBY_TEAM=norax

Subject: Revised commission scheme — branch rollout

Team,

Effective next quarter, Nordqvist Retail moves to a tiered commission: 3% to target, 7% beyond. Branch managers should brief staff by the 15th and update local trackers. Payroll handles the transition automatically; no manual adjustments. Questions go through regional ops. One further item is for this group only.

board note of kageg-bahof: The renewal with Holwynax Holdings closes at $2 million a year, 5 percent below the last contract. Project Ulaath slips by two quarters because of the supplier delay.

**Q: Where's the evacuation-chair store, and can anyone get in?**

Good question! The evac-chair store at Brindlewood House is the grey door next to the Stairwell C landing on level 2. All new starters at Kestrelmark get access automatically once your induction is logged — usually within two days of your first shift. Inside you'll find four chairs plus the quick-start cards; please don't borrow anything for "testing" without telling Facilities first. To open the door, tap your badge and then punch in the code below.

door code, kawip-bagap: bdg-HQEWH-4

## Formula sandbox tuning

User-supplied formulas in Gridmoor execute inside a restricted interpreter with hard ceilings on time, memory, and call depth. Reviewers should confirm any change to these ceilings is justified in the PR description, since raising them widens the abuse surface. Defaults were chosen from production traces. The current limits are as follows.

limits module of tafog-fawip:
WEIGHTS = {
    "julix": 57,
    "lamys": 992,
    "kasvan": 209,
    "quenok": 750,
    "alddor": 259,
    "oliath": 1009,
    "wenix": 815,
}